For my final year major project, I have developed Elevrack – a car-mounted bike rack system designed to simplify the process of transporting bikes, particularly for users of heavier bikes like e-bikes, and those who struggle with the lifting demands of traditional systems.

Hello, I’m Elliott, thanks for checking out my project! I am 3rd year Product Design and Manufacture (BEng) Student at the University of Nottingham. I grew up in London, which often surprises people given that I had the pleasure of serving as the Mountain Bike Captain for the university's cycling society. I’m a keen sports enthusiast and love getting involved in activities like cycling, surfing, climbing, tennis, and more.

At school, I really enjoyed Design and Technology, but I didn’t have the chance to take it at A-level. Instead, I studied Physics, Maths, and Economics – a combination that eventually led me to discover my passion for design at Nottingham.

Through my degree, I’ve developed a strong interest in CAD and prototyping, and I’m particularly excited about pursuing a career in sports equipment or automotive design engineering.

One of my most notable projects involved designing and prototyping a functional chain tensioner for full suspension bikes. Feel free to explore more of my work in my portfolio linked below!
